Commercial Photographer based in Reading, specialising in Food photography and Corporate Photography. Shooting on location with portable studio kit, to provide mouth watering and eye catching images for your website and marketing material. My background in Financial Services gives me an excellent understanding of corporate culture and branding. I will work professionally with you throughout the process to decide the best way to use the images to promote your business. For conference and event photography I will be unobtrusive so as not to disrupt your day, but can bring a portable studio to set up separately for evening events and portraits. Banff Photography is the most diverse and passionate provider of retail, professional and attraction photography services in the Canadian Rockies. Our team of over 15 Photo-istas (think barista with a camera) and Photo-tainers enthusiastically turn Rocky Mountain experiences into treasured photographic memories. Nagios XI versions prior to 2026R1.1 are vulnerable to local privilege escalation due to an unsafe interaction between sudo permissions and application file permissions. A user‑accessible maintenance script may be executed as root via sudo and includes an application file that is writable by a lower‑privileged user. A local attacker with access to the application account can modify this file to introduce malicious code, which is then executed with elevated privileges when the script is run. Successful exploitation results in arbitrary code execution as the root user.

SIPGO is a library for writing SIP services in the GO language. Starting in version 0.3.0 and prior to version 1.0.0-alpha-1, a nil pointer dereference vulnerability is in the SIPGO library's `NewResponseFromRequest` function that affects all normal SIP operations. The vulnerability allows remote attackers to crash any SIP application by sending a single malformed SIP request without a To header. The vulnerability occurs when SIP message parsing succeeds for a request missing the To header, but the response creation code assumes the To header exists without proper nil checks. This affects routine operations like call setup, authentication, and message handling - not just error cases. This vulnerability affects all SIP applications using the sipgo library, not just specific configurations or edge cases, as long as they make use of the `NewResponseFromRequest` function. Version 1.0.0-alpha-1 contains a patch for the issue.

GLPI is a free asset and IT management software package. Starting in version 9.1.0 and prior to version 10.0.21, an unauthorized user with an API access can read all knowledge base entries. Users should upgrade to 10.0.21 to receive a patch.
